West Pharmaceutical Services Updates Annual Guidance
Date:10/4/2007

- Maintains EPS Outlook Excluding Discrete Tax Items -

LIONVILLE, Penn., Oct. 4 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- West Pharmaceutical Services, Inc. (NYSE: WST) today provided an update to its full year 2007 guidance. The Company is maintaining its full year revenue guidance at $1 billion, and its earnings per share guidance at between $2.27 and $2.37 per diluted share excluding discrete tax items. The Company expects to recognize in the third quarter a net discrete tax charge of up to $0.06 per diluted share as a result of changes in its estimates of tax obligations not related to current year operating results, which amount would offset the $0.06 of discrete tax benefits recognized in the second quarter of 2007.

The Company is issuing this release in order to clarify the status of its annual guidance. The Company anticipates reporting its results for the three and nine-month periods ended September 30, 2007, and will provide any further updates and details relating to guidance in its quarterly earnings release and analyst call, on November 1, 2007.

About West Pharmaceutical Services, Inc.

West Pharmaceutical Services, Inc. is a global manufacturer of components and systems for injectable drug delivery, including stoppers and seals for vials, and closures and disposable components used in syringe, IV and blood collection systems. The Company also provides products with application to the personal care, food and beverage markets. Headquartered in Lionville, Pennsylvania, West Pharmaceutical Services supports its partners and customers from 50 locations throughout North America, South America, Europe, Mexico, Japan, Asia and Australia.
